Output 247a824afcccb314423fbd2d18e103da1791656c6fb35b0c46ad84e479c75fcd:263

value
26750244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73d5535dd4b3fa98708e84183be8fd1fc5b114b7 OP_EQUAL
address
3CFVBjJyXRcLQxNqXVQKB5J982JKJ5A8Z2
transaction
247a824afcccb314423fbd2d18e103da1791656c6fb35b0c46ad84e479c75fcd
confirmations
409169
spent
true